Brief summary
The purpose of this study is to evaluate the long-term safety and efficacy of Deucravacitinib in participants who have previously been enrolled in a Deucravacitinib Phase 2 study for moderate to severe Crohn's disease or moderate to severe Ulcerative Colitis.

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s)
Number of participants experiencing AEs, SAEs, AEs leading to study discontinuation, and AEs of interest (AEIs). An Adverse Event (AE) is defined as any new untoward medical occurrence or worsening of a preexisting medical condition in a clinical investigation participant administered study treatment and that does not necessarily have a causal relationship with this treatment. SAEs is any untoward medical occurrence that, at any dose: results in death; is life-threatening; requires inpatient hospitalization; results significant disability; or is a congenital anomaly/birth defect. TEAEs are defined as AEs with an onset date on or after the first dose of study treatment up to 30 days after the last dose of study treatment in the study, or if a pre-existing condition worsens in severity or becomes serious after receiving the first dose of study treatment
Time frame: From first dose to 30 days post last dose (Up to 110 weeks)
Population: All treated participants
| Arm | Measure | Group | Value (COUNT_OF_PARTICIPANTS)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Crohn's Disease |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TEAEs | 18 Participants |
| Crohn's Disease |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| AEs of Interest - Creatine Kinase events | 2 Participants |
| Crohn's Disease |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TESAEs | 2 Participants |
| Crohn's Disease |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| AEs of Interest - Skin-related events | 0 Participants |
| Crohn's Disease |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TEAEs leading to study discontinuation | 1 Participants |
| Ulcerative Colitis |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| AEs of Interest - Skin-related events | 2 Participants |
| Ulcerative Colitis |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TEAEs leading to study discontinuation | 1 Participants |
| Ulcerative Colitis |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TESAEs | 2 Participants |
| Ulcerative Colitis |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| AEs of Interest - Creatine Kinase events | 3 Participants |
| Ulcerative Colitis | Number of Participants With Treatment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Treatment Emergent Serious Adverse Events (TESAEs) | TEAEs | 19 Participants |
